### Step 4: Apply remediation config

Per the Quillhaven stale-cache postmortem, the old invalidation settings allowed entries to outlive their source records by hours. Before promoting build 14.2, replace the cache tier's config with the corrected values below. Do not merge with existing overrides; the postmortem traced the bug to a partial override. Verify all three regions restart cleanly, then sign off in the release tracker. The corrected configuration to apply is as follows.

config for faweg-yajef:
DRUIX_HOST=druix.lumicsys.internal
DRUIX_PORT=9000

Ticket: Calendar sync stuck — expired creds

Hey on-call — the Plannerly sync between Meadowcal and the internal Roomgrid service started throwing 401s around 03:40, so everyone's meeting rooms are double-booked this morning. Turns out the service credential expired over the weekend and the auto-renew job never fired (known flake, see the Harbinger ticket). I minted a fresh key and verified it against staging. Drop it into the sync worker's env and restart. New key follows.

gateway credential: kto23_LX9A4ys6i4nzHtpOLNLodKK

TICKET-2093: Signature verification failure on Renderhollow transcode workers

The nightly rollout to the Renderhollow transcoding farm halted because worker image v5.8.1 failed signature verification on all three regions. Root cause: the build was signed with the retired spring key after the rotation cutover on Monday. The artifact itself is intact; no tampering suspected. Action for release manager: re-sign v5.8.1 with the active key and re-trigger the rollout. The active signing key follows below.

signing key of bagap-yawep = bky13_TbfT6ZMUoGJo2

Facilities Ticket — Cleaning Crew Access, Brindle Annex

For new starters handling evening lock-up: the Sorano Cleaning crew arrives nightly at 21:30 via the annex side door. Check their rota sheet, note arrival in the log, and ensure the storeroom is relocked afterward. To let them through the side door, enter the access code below.

badge for yaweg-hafog: bdg-GX-6